Submit an Incident Report

LEIA Nigeria operates a voluntary incident reporting scheme for lifting-related incidents, near-misses, and dangerous occurrences across Nigeria. All reports are treated confidentially.

Reported incidents help LEIA develop targeted safety bulletins and training content, and contribute to a better industry-wide understanding of lifting risks and causal factors. You do not need to be a member to submit a report.

Confidential
All reports are handled in strict confidence. Personal details may be anonymised.
Non-Punitive
Reports are for learning and improvement only. LEIA does not share data with regulators without consent.

New Lifting Operations Safety Guidance Released

LEIA Nigeria publishes updated guidance on safe lifting practices in the oil & gas sector, aligned with LOLER requirements and Nigerian regulatory expectations.

LEIA Partners with LEEA to Strengthen Standards

A formal memorandum of understanding signed between LEIA Nigeria and LEEA UK deepens cooperation on training accreditation, technical standards, and member mobility.
